150 people enjoyed the Wellington launch of Our Stories at The New Dowse gallery in Lower Hutt. Tony Shaw from the IHC Foundation was the MC for the evening and a variety of speakers including local people with lived experience of disability talked about the importance of breaking down barriers to inclusion in the community for disabled people.
The launch was followed the next week by an employment evening sponsored by the Hutt Chamber of Commerce and Business Hutt Valley. Guests Kendall, Jessie and Maria spoke to a group of 35 people about their experiences of employment. This personal experience was followed by Workbridge and Work and Income outlining ways in which they could assist employers to take the step and employ a person with a disability.
